Identity of Wounded Suspect in Lawton Police Shooting Released

Lawton Police have released the identity of a wounded suspect involved in a shootout with Lawton Police Wednesday morning.

Police say 22 year old Demetrius Miller remains in Comanche County Memorial Hospital.

According to police, Miller has been placed under arrest for the shooting of Officer Eric Weatherly.

Police say Weatherly is still in the hospital but is expected to make a full recovery.

A second suspect, 22 year old Jamal Erwin, or "Jay-Red" Johnson, was arrested Wednesday.
 
Lawton police say the incident started around 10:30 Wednesday morning when Officer Eric Weatherly responded to a call in the 1600 block of Northwest 27th Street.

Investigators say Officer Weatherly made contact with Miller and Erwin, who then began shooting at him. A second officer, Craig Lymen arrived and joined in the exchange of gunfire. Officer Weatherly and Miller were shot and wounded. Both were transported to Comanche County Memorial Hospital. The Oklahoma State Bureau of Investigation is handling the investigation since officers were involved in the shooting.

Because of Lawton Police Department policy, both Officer Lymen and Officer Weatherly have been placed on Administrative Leave pending the outcome of the investigation.
